The Manager Process Manufacturing 2 will have the responsibility of managing supervisors who manage shop floor personnel. The selected candidate will have the responsibility, authority, and accountability for leading the manufacturing activities of a cross functional product team.
This includes responsibility for the cost, quality and the delivery schedule related to the product line.
Experience in composites fabrication, bonding, and equipment/processes is required to determine root cause for part defects and implementing practical corrective actions.
In this role you will maintain complete responsibility that performance goals are met daily.
Expectations for success will be to develop and maintain open lines of communication to ensure supplier and customer satisfaction, promote the development of self-directed work groups and a work environment which encourages training and opportunities for its work force, ensure compliance to all state, corporate and sector policies related to health, safety, environmental and equal opportunity regulations.
Key Responsibilities:

Providing direction and coaching to technicians and front-line managers in the Advanced Composites Center
* Responsible for cost, quality, schedule performance and team engagement as part of the Operations leadership team. Root cause investigation into failed composite processes is required.
* The selected candidate should thrive in a fast-paced work environment with high expectations, significantly diverse assignments, collaborative/team settings across all levels.
* Ensures team members receive the required training and prepares the daily work plans in support of overall program objectives.
* Provides leadership/direction to ensure all affordability initiatives and opportunities for process improvements are systematically identified, pursued, and supported.
* Encourages and provides direction for career development of employees, including educational options for highly motivated employees.

Basic Qualifications:

Bachelor's Degree AND 5 years of experience in an aerospace, automotive, military, manufacturing and/or maintenance environment OR High School Diploma/GED AND 9 years of experience in an aerospace, automotive, military, manufacturing and/or maintenance environment
* Composites process and manufacturing build experience required
* Must have 2 years of prior management/leadership experience
* Must have the ability to obtain DoD Secret security clearance (US Citizenship required) as well as the ability to obtain and maintain Program Special Access
Preferred Qualifications:

Bachelor's Degree
* Demonstrated ability to effectively communicate and present presentations with various levels of leadership
Salary Range: $114,100 - $171,100
